SENATE BILL 2 RESOLUTION <br /> Motion was made by Commissioner Willhoit, seconded by <br /> Commissioner Halkiotis to adopt the following resolution and authorize <br /> the Chair to sign: <br /> WHEREAS, Orange County is eligible to receive $242,450 in Senate Bill 2 <br /> funds over a two year period for sewer projects; and <br /> WHEREAS, the Orange County Board of Commissioners committed to construct <br /> a sewer collection system in the Efland-Cheeks area of the County by a <br /> resolution adopted on November 20, 1984; and <br /> WHEREAS, it has been the intent of the Orange County Board of <br /> Commissioners to finance a portion of this sewer collection system with <br /> Senate Bill 2 sewer funds since these funds became available; and <br /> WHEREAS, it was the intent of the Orange County Board of Commissioners to <br /> adopt a resolution allocating Senate Bill 2 funds to this project by <br /> December 31, 1986 but was not able to do so due to the lack of bids <br /> pertaining to the project; and <br /> WHEREAS, an amended project ordinance for this sewer collection system <br /> was adopted by the Orange County Board of Commissioners on February 2, <br /> 1987 appropriating $203, 850 in Senate Bill 2 funds for this <br /> N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the Orange CountyroBoard of <br /> Commissioners that in the interests of the health of the citizens and for <br /> the good of the environment of the County, the Board does hereby formally <br /> allocate Senate Bill 2 sewer funds in the amount of $203,850 to the <br /> Efland Sewer Project; and <br /> B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the Orange County Board of Commissioners <br /> hereby requests that the State of North Carolina encumber $203, 850 of <br /> Senate Bill 2 sewer funds for the use of Orange County, and <br /> B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ED by the Orange County Board of Commissioners that <br /> the Board understands that Senate Bill 2 funds must be matched equally <br /> with local funds for the project indicated. <br /> Adopted this 24th day of March, 1987. <br /> VOTE: UNANIMOUS. <br /> H.
